The SM-N976N has 4 CSC options built-in. KOO is the unbranded Samsung code. There are 3 for the 3 major carriers in Korea: SK Telecom, kt Olleh, and LG U+

The American CSC does not contain information for Canadian carriers. After you flash the American U1 firmware, flash the Canadian CSC. There is only one CSC for Canada, and it contains information for all the Canadian carriers (Bell, Rogers, Telus, etc.). After flashing the Canadian CSC, when you insert a SIM from a Canadian carrier it applies the settings for your carrier's VoLTE, wi-fi calling, APN, etc.

It seems, that many more 'branded' CSCs are now part of Multi-CSC. For me, this is DTM (T-Mobile DE). It osed to not be part of multi-CSC but it is now part of OXM.
This means, that you can not force it anymore, as you already ARE having the exact same firmware with the 'branded' CSC. Just checked, OPV is in deed part of OXM now.

Enable OEM unlock does not trip Knox. As long as you flash official Samsung firmware files in Odin Knox is never tripped
My own personal experience on S10 and above is you cannot flash a different CSC with OEM Unlock disabled
(Flash completes successfully but CSC doesn't change)
